The Issue
Help us in our urgent campaign to save the critically endangered Javan Rhino from the brink of extinction. These magnificent creatures once roamed peacefully in their natural habitat, but now they face the looming threat of poaching driven by the demand for their horns in illegal wildlife trade, particularly for their alleged medicinal properties in China.
With only approximately 76 individuals left in the entire world, the Javan Rhino population is teetering on the edge of extinction. These gentle giants are confined to a tiny fraction of their original range, residing solely in Ujung Klondike National Park in Java, Indonesia. Their current habitat is less than 1% of what it used to be, making them extremely vulnerable to threats such as poaching and habitat loss.
Despite their critically endangered status, Javan Rhinos are still being illegally hunted for profit, pushing them closer to the brink of extinction with each passing day. We cannot allow these majestic creatures to disappear forever from our planet.
